An arctic cold front will move quickly east across the region through daybreak. This will usher in a much colder airmass with temperatures quickly falling below freezing.
Snow showers can be expected this morning with snow accumulations of a half inch or less possible. This will combine with the falling temperatures to produce slick spots on untreated roadways. In addition, brisk west winds will gust to 25 to 35 mph at times this morning.
The morning commute will be affected by these conditions. Please allow for some extra time to reach your destination. Be prepared for slick spots, especially on bridges an overpasses.

Schools to cooperate on new ag program
By William Kincaid
CELINA - Tri Star Career Compact is joining forces with another career tech program to offer students a more comprehensive agricultural education.
Tri Star's ag industrial technology, a longtime staple program formerly known as ag mechanics, has informally partnered with Lima Senior High School's fledgling agricultural education program. The collaboration will have the two programs exchange equipment, materials and supplies and other resources, officials said. [More]
